Indulge your sweet tooth with a delightful dessert that perfectly marries the rich flavors of sweet potatoes and the crunch of pecans in our Sweet Potato Pudding with Pecan and Gingersnap Topping. This recipe is a celebration of decadent autumn ingredients, offering a warm, comforting dish that is perfect for any occasion. Whether you’re entertaining guests or simply wanting to treat yourself after a long day, this pudding promises to uplift your spirits.

The pudding itself is a velvety concoction made from creamy mashed sweet potatoes, half and half, and a hint of orange juice that adds a bright, zesty note. It’s infused with aromatic pumpkin pie spice that evokes the essence of fall, making each bite an experience to savor. Topped with a crunchy mix of toasted pecans and gingersnap cookies, the contrast in textures enhances the flavor profile, adding a delightful crunch to the softness of the pudding.

With a preparation time of only 135 minutes and a generous yield of 12 servings, it’s a perfect choice for family gatherings, holiday feasts, or even as a standout treat at a potluck. This sweet potato pudding not only satisfies your dessert cravings but also delivers a dose of comfort food nostalgia, making it a dish everyone will love. Directions

  1. Toss first 4 ingredients in mediumbowl.
  2. Add butter; using fingertips, rub inuntil well blended. Cover; chill. DO AHEAD: Can be made 1 day ahead. Keep chilled.
  3. Preheat oven to 400°F. Roastpotatoes on baking sheet until tender, 45to 60 minutes. Cool.
  4. Cut in half lengthwise.Scoop flesh into bowl; mash.
  5. Transfer 4cups potatoes to large bowl. DO AHEAD: Canbe made 1 day ahead. Cover; chill. Bring toroom temperature before continuing.
  6. Preheat oven to 350°F. Butter 13x9x2-inch baking dish.
  7. Add half and half and next5 ingredients to potatoes. Using mixer, beaton low speed until blended. Season with saltand pepper.
  8. Add yolks 1 at a time, blendingafter each addition. Using clean dry beaters,beat whites in another large bowl untilfoamy.
  9. Add salt and cream of tartar. Beatuntil peaks form. Fold whites into potatoes;spoon into dish.
  10. Sprinkle with topping.
  11. Bake pudding until puffed and brown,about 45 minutes.
  12. Serve immediately.
